CloudExtel has raised ₹200 crore in debt from leading private sector banks to expand its metro fibre network and build infrastructure to support rising AI-led data demand. The deal is one of the first instances of project financing for a fibre network by lenders.

The company, in a press release, said its existing shareholders have also put in additional equity on a proportionate basis. CloudExtel said the funds will be used to speed up network rollout and strengthen its presence in major metros.
